Web• The molecular geometry is the arrangement of the atoms in space. • To determine the shape of a molecule we distinguish between lone pairs and bonding pairs. • We use the electron domain geometry to help us predict the molecular geometry. • Draw the Lewis structure. • Count the total number of electron domains around the central atom. The best place to start when trying to figure out a molecule's geometry is its Lewis structure. Carbon disulfide, "CS"_2, will have a total of 16 valence electrons, 4 from the carbon atom and 6 from each of the two sulfur atoms. The central carbon atom will form double bonds with the two sulfur atoms.
